Ciliary Ganglion
A parasympathetic ganglion located in the orbit that plays a role in controlling the ciliary muscles of the eye, affecting lens shape and pupil size.
Otic Ganglion
A small parasympathetic ganglion located just below the ear, associated with the glossopharyngeal nerve, involved in salivation and lacrimation.
Parasympathetic Cranial
Pertaining to the cranial part of the parasympathetic nervous system, which helps control bodily functions when at rest, like saliva production and slowing the heartbeat.
Glossopharyngeal
A cranial nerve (IX) that manages taste and other functions in the throat and tongue.
